In collaboration with the SIHA Network, VOSOMWO organized a two-day training in Hargeisa aimed at strengthening the political awareness and leadership capacity of women and girls from minority communities. This training served as a prelude to similar capacity-building trainings planned in other regions of the country, which will ultimately reach 75 women and girls in total.
The official opening session was attended by representatives from the Women’s Wing of the KULMIYE Party, the Deputy Chairperson of the NOW Women’s Organization, a representative of the SIHA Network, the Head of the United Nations Office for Somaliland and Somalia, and officials from the Somaliland Ministry of Justice.
Through these trainings, women and girls from culturally disadvantaged communities are being equipped with knowledge and skills in democratic leadership and political participation, with the objective of identifying and supporting politically capable and motivated minority women to actively participate in political and decision-making processes in Somaliland.
